Marina Mile Pizza
Public records show 13 inspections at Marina Mile Pizza stretching back to 2023. On Mar 5, 2026, the health department conducted the most recent visit. Diners can read the low risk label as a sign that recent inspections have gone well.
There hasn't been much movement either way: counts have stayed near three violations per visit across recent inspections.
The most common issue across all inspections has been “time/temperature control for safety food cold held”, showing up five times.
The city-wide average is 80, putting Marina Mile Pizza squarely in typical territory. The full picture is one of consistent compliance.
